Luke 9:45-55

45 1But they did not understand this saying, and 2it was concealed from them, so that they might not perceive it. And they were afraid to ask him about this saying.

Who Is the Greatest?

46 3An argument arose among them as to which of them was the greatest.
47 But Jesus, knowing the reasoning of their hearts, took a child and put him by his side
48 and said to them, 4"Whoever receives this child in my name receives me, and 5whoever receives me receives him who sent me. For 6he who is least among you all is the one who is great."

Anyone Not Against Us Is For Us

49 7John answered, "Master, we saw someone 8casting out demons in your name, and 9we tried to stop him, because he does not follow with us."
50 But Jesus said to him, "Do not stop him, 10for the one who is not against you is for you."

A Samaritan Village Rejects Jesus

51 When the days drew near for 11him to be taken up, 12he set his face 13to go to Jerusalem.
52 And 14he sent messengers ahead of him, who went and entered a village of 15the Samaritans, to make preparations for him.
53 But 16the people did not receive him, because 17his face was set toward Jerusalem.
54 And when his disciples James and John saw it, they said, "Lord, do you want us to tell 18fire to come down from heaven and consume them?"[a]
55 But he turned and rebuked them.[b]

Footnotes 2

  • [a]. Some manuscripts add as Elijah did
  • [b]. Some manuscripts add and he said, "You do not know what manner of spirit you are of; for the Son of Man came not to destroy people's lives but to save them"
